DevWorkspace Pro's answer:
It's like Laravel Herd, but for DDEV, i.e. it makes building web applications super easy via the intuitive dektop GUI
DevWorkspace Pro's answer:
It adds other affordances that makes working with, and managing your web apps a breeze, such as remote ssh with auto-session keep-alive, executing code on server for easy remote debugging, etc.
DevWorkspace Pro's answer:
DevWorkspace Pro primarily targets web developers
DevWorkspace Pro's answer:
I was using Laravel Herd but switched to DDEV and learnt that DDEV does not have a Laravel Herd equivalent, so I built a supercharged GUI for DDEV with affordances that 10x the DX
DevWorkspace Pro's answer:
It's an Electron app like Discord and VS Code, and intentional care was taken to ensure it is very fast and lightweight.

JSFiddle cannot be used to host code on your server. The code has to be on JSFiddle and is public all the time.
What is missing from JSFiddle is live previews. You have to basically refresh the page by clicking on the play button. And compared to other playgrounds, JSFiddle is probably the slowest. Another slightly frustrating...
